Personal data Catharine Fraukeline Janssen 

  • She was born on June 18, 1884 in Weener, Ostfriesland, Hannover, Preußen.
  • (note1) .Source 1
    Source: Jan-Dirk Zimmermann
  • She died before 1995 in fortasse, Ostfriesland, Deutschland.
  • A child of Hinderk Janssen and Frouke Tepen

Catharina Fraukeline Janssen

Source: Author: Zimmermann, Jan-Dirk, Title: Familienbuch der Ev.-ref. Kirchengemeinde WEENER ... 1674-1900, Teilband ii, (Publication location: Weener, Niedersachsen, Publisher: Eigenverlag, Publication date: MMXV), Seite 1255, Repository: Ostfriesen Heritage Soc., Grundy Ctr., IA with holdings at Wellsburg, IA pub. lib.

[Seite 1255]

"8256. Janssen, Hinderk 8213, Kaufmann zu Weener, * 29.8.1840 Bunderneuland, Sohn des Tagelöhner Garrelt Karels Janssen und Reina Hinderks Busma, oo 7.5.1874 Weener, Frouke Tepen 14578, * 2.11.1849 Weener, Tochter des Schmiedemeister Hinderk Roelfs Tepen und Trientje Gerjets Groen

Kinder Heinrich * 2.3.1875 Weener = 16.7.1875 Weener
...
[7] Catharina Hinderika Fraukeline * 17.1.1882 Weener = 6.6.1882 Weener
...
[9] Catharine Fraukeline * 18.6.1884 Weener
..."
